> On Tue, Nov 09, 2004 at 01:29:19PM +0100, Tk421 wrote:
>
> > I've made some functions, an i want these functions to be used
> > by a specified user, but i don't want this user can see the code
> > of the functions.
>
> Are you trying to hide the code itself, or are you just trying to
> hide sensitive data embedded in the code?  If the latter, then you
> might be able to move the data to a table and create the function
> with SECURITY DEFINER.
